Bull City Forward is a community of innovators who develop and scale break-through solutions to community challenges and entrepreneurial opportunities. We work across industries from banking to education, clean tech to software; in teams and alone; in nonprofits and for-profits; in pursuit of financial success and social impact. We believe that diversity breeds innovation and that a community of change agents from a wide variety of backgrounds and sectors can create a better future not just our local community, but our planet. Our goal is to increase your chances of success.

Membership Levels
Community Membership
For those engaged in the community, social and educational programming, services, and concept of Bull City Forward, but not in need of space. All membership benefits listed above are enjoyed by Community Members for $25 per month.
Space Membership
For those looking for work space in addition to a community, programming, and resources. Space Members engage in all of the benefits of a community membership, in addition to the amenities of the social innovation campus, such as: meeting rooms; internet, printing, and copying; a shared kitchen; and a constantly evolving stream of engaged co-workers.
